Livestock Disaster and Emergency Programs payments in Adair County, Missouri totaled $1.1 million from 1995-2023.

From 1995 to 2023, the top 10 percent of Livestock Disaster and Emergency Programs payment recipients were paid 41 percent of Livestock Disaster and Emergency Programs recipients.
